authorizationChecker->isGranted in a phpUnit test

Viewed 2145

I'm currently creating my unit test for my application but it's the first time I do it.

I want to test this function :

/**
 * This method search if the user is already in a team for the same tournament than the one passed in argument
 * @param User $user
 * @param Team $team
 * @return bool|Team|mixed
 */
public function isAlreadyApplicant($user, Team $team) {
    if (!$user || !$this->authorizationChecker->isGranted("ROLE_USER")) {
        return false;
    }

    foreach ($user->getApplications() as $userTeam) {
        /** @var Team $userTeam */
        if ($userTeam->getTournament()->getId() === $team->getTournament()->getId()) {
            return $userTeam;
        }
    }

    foreach ($user->getTeams() as $userTeam) {
        /** @var Team $userTeam */
        if ($userTeam->getTournament()->getId() === $team->getTournament()->getId()) {
            return $userTeam;
        }
    }

    foreach ($user->getManagedTeam() as $userTeam) {
        /** @var Team $userTeam */
        if ($userTeam->getTournament()->getId() === $team->getTournament()->getId()) {
            return $userTeam;
        }
    }
    return false;
}

As you can see, the first test is to check if the user have the ROLE_USER.

When I try to "log my user", I have this message :

Fatal error: Call to a member function getToken() on null in \vendor\symfony\symfony\src\Symfony\Component\Security\Core\Authorization\AuthorizationChecker.php on line 56

I tried what I found in the Symfony doc but I must miss something. This is my test Class:
